GRAPE HARVEST 2022
This wine is the result of a research project into the specific characteristics of the Sangiovese grape traditionally grown in the area and is produced by natural fermentation using indigenous yeasts to enhance these original characteristics.



The label depicts a pair of lovers, because it is love that gives life to this and all the winery's wines.
GRAPE HARVEST 2022
This is the first wine project of Amaracmand, born from the conviction of Marco Vianello and his wife Tiziana that: “Imperfection is subjective. No wine is perfect, so not even the best wines are perfect. It is their imperfections that make them unique. It is imperfection that creates style”.



The label features a drawing of a woman, because this is the wine that co-owner Marco dedicated to his wife and owner Tiziana.
The sparkle is obtained using the long charmat method, which makes it a pleasant but also full-bodied wine, therefore suitable both as an aperitif and throughout the meal.
